You are not going to save money having your own RV unless you are used to going to a close motel, then buying restaurant food nearby so you can visit your friends.
Travelling distances in a rig instead of a small car is much more expensive per mile, but stopping off the road in remote campgrounds where the stars come out, and you have some bevvies and steaks on your own bbq is just so much better when you slow down and enjoy the journey.
It's a change in lifestyle, not a dollar saved or spent.
